About

Alka Kumari is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Filtration and Separation and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Alka Kumari has authored 45 papers receiving a total of 552 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 10 papers in Filtration and Separation and 10 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Alka Kumari’s work include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(10 papers), Crystallization and Solubility Studies (8 papers) and Thermodynamic properties of mixtures (7 papers). Alka Kumari is often cited by papers focused on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(10 papers), Crystallization and Solubility Studies (8 papers) and Thermodynamic properties of mixtures (7 papers). Alka Kumari collaborates with scholars based in India, Australia and Spain. Alka Kumari's co-authors include Doongar R. Chaudhary, Bhavanath Jha, B. Satyavathi, G. S. Prasad, Vijay Paul, Bhaswati Bhattacharya, Tripti Agarwal, Anil Kumar Pinnaka, Rajarathinam Parthasarathy and S. Chakkaravarthi and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Hazardous Materials, Scientific Reports and Food Chemistry.
